Rabat, Morocco
Interior of the Mausoleum of Mohammed V shows the royal burial chamber with the white onyx tomb of Mohammed V placed in the center below the visitor gallery, while the tombs of Hassan II and Prince Abdallah are positioned on the lower level toward the corners. The interior is lined with zellij tilework, carved plaster, brass elements, and marble surfaces, and above the chamber hangs a dome made of mahogany wood with coloured glass. This 360-degree panorama records the mausoleum as a ceremonial interior defined by tombs, ornament, and a clearly structured viewing space.
